Context Readings

Divisiveness And Immaturity

4 for when one may say, 'I, indeed, am of Paul;' and another, 'I -- of Apollos;' are ye not fleshly? 5 Who, then, is Paul, and who Apollos, but ministrants through whom ye did believe, and to each as the Lord gave? 6 I planted, Apollos watered, but God was giving growth;
